Good morning! It’s 13th January, and here’s your India daily news capsule.
Germany and India face challenges in strengthening their strategic ties amid differing ideologies.
Supreme Court requests Election Commission's response on TMC MPs' plea regarding West Bengal's SIR process.
CBI questions actor Vijay about his departure during the Karur stampede investigation.
Delhi experiences a cold wave with temperatures plunging to a record low of 2.9 degrees Celsius.
Malaysia blocks Grok amid controversy over nonconsensual sexualized images and AI deepfakes.
Iran employs a kill switch to disrupt Starlink internet amid ongoing protests.
Chinese Communist Party delegation visits India to meet BJP and RSS officials for discussions.
Supreme Court criticizes a judicial officer accused of misconduct on a train, blocking reinstatement.
Supreme Court mandates completion of Bengaluru Municipal Corporation elections by June 30.
India's retail inflation rises for the second consecutive month, reaching 1.33 percent in December.
Exclusive: India proposes requiring smartphone makers to provide source code for enhanced security.
Trump's proposed 10 percent credit card rate cap raises questions and hopes for India.
Kriti Sanon's sister Nupur Sanon weds Stebin Ben in a dreamy white wedding celebration.
Mohammad Nabi reacts to IPL controversies, expressing frustration over unrelated discussions.
India faces the second highest economic burden from diabetes, highlighting a global health crisis.
